About Historical English Handwriting
What Is Old English Handwriting?
Old English handwriting refers here to historical English-language handwriting found in old records, letters, wills, deeds, and family documents. It is not the same as translating the Old English language.

Secretary Hand and Court Hand
Many early modern English documents use secretary hand, court hand, or other formal writing styles that can be difficult for modern readers to recognize.
Copperplate and Later Cursive
Later English letters, diaries, and family documents may use copperplate or flowing cursive styles with decorative strokes and tightly connected words.
Common in Genealogy Records
Historical English handwriting is often found in wills, parish records, deeds, court papers, family letters, estate files, journals, and local archives.
Why It Is Hard to Read
Why Old English Handwriting Is Difficult
Historical English handwriting is not just messy cursive. It often uses unfamiliar letterforms, legal wording, old spelling, and writing styles that make records difficult to read today.
Historical Handwriting Styles
Old English-language documents may use secretary hand, court hand, copperplate, or other historical writing styles that look very different from modern handwriting.
Legal and Record Abbreviations
Wills, deeds, parish books, and court records often include shortened words, names, dates, and legal phrases that are hard to interpret without experience.
Old Spelling and Damaged Pages
Historic documents may include older spelling, faded ink, stains, cramped lines, torn paper, and uneven scans that make manual transcription slow and uncertain.
